Connie deposited $1200 in a new account that earns 3% simple interest. After 7 years, how much interest will she have earned?​

Respuesta :

Naseeem88
Naseeem88 Naseeem88
  • 11-02-2021

Answer:

$252

Step-by-step explanation:

First, converting R percent to r a decimal

r = R/100 = 3%/100 = 0.03 per year,

then, solving our equation

I = 1200 × 0.03 × 7 = 252

I = $ 252.00

The simple interest accumulated

on a principal of $ 1,200.00

at a rate of 3% per year

for 7 years is $ 252.00.
